The two buildings represent the main powers in Loja. Starting on the left, you see a silhouette of the City Gate spire, which represents order and organization. In the middle is San Sebastián Tower, which stands for freedom, the desire to succeed, and to meet our collective goals. The mountains represent the place where this project “lives” - Ecuador’s southern Andes - a place where you will see the most beautiful sunsets and shades of light reflected on the mountains surrounding our entire province.
